What is the main focus of your site?
Ryan’s Reviews is a site dedicated to reviewing low- and no-budget films of all genres

What are your blogging goals, personally and/or professionally? In other words, what, if anything, are you trying to get out your blog?
I am a low-budget filmmaker that knows how hard it can be to get a review, so I write reviews for other low-budget filmmakers!

Do you prefer an interactive community for your blog or are you the teacher and your readers the students?
I would love more interaction, but much of the low budget world is unknown to the general reader, so it ends up more teacher/student.

How long have you been movie blogging for, and how frequent do you post updates to your site?
Originally started on MySpace in 2005, recently re-started on WordPress; try to add 1 new review every week at minimum.

Name up to three of your favorite movies (and no more).
Reservoir Dogs (I have a tattoo of that one, so it’s obligatory on a “favorite” list), Frankenhooker, City of Lost Children

How did you hear about the LAMB?
from Playground of Doom

Any additional comments, or give yourself an interview question that’s not listed above.
People need to realize that lots of money does not necessarily equal a good movie, and that low budget film can deserve as much notice and praise as any big budget film.
